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
SHOW COLUMNS
Zeigt nur die Spaltennamen für eine einzelne angegebene Tabelle, Athena-Ansicht oder Datenkatalogansicht an. Um detailliertere Informationen für Athena-Ansichten zu erhalten, fragen Sie AWS Glue Data Catalog stattdessen die ab. Informationen und Beispiele finden Sie in den folgenden Abschnitten im Fragen Sie die ab AWS Glue Data Catalog-Thema:
-
Zur Anzeige von Spaltenmetadaten, wie z. B. dem Datentyp, siehe Spalten für eine bestimmte Tabelle oder Ansicht auflisten oder durchsuchen.
-
Um alle Spalten für alle Tabellen in einer bestimmten Datenbank in
AwsDataCatalog
anzuzeigen, siehe Spalten für eine bestimmte Tabelle oder Ansicht auflisten oder durchsuchen. -
Um alle Spalten für alle Tabellen in allen Datenbanken in
AwsDataCatalog
anzuzeigen, siehe Listet alle Spalten für alle Tabellen auf. -
Informationen zur Anzeige der Spalten, die bestimmte Tabellen in einer Datenbank gemeinsam haben, finden Sie unterListet die Spalten auf, die bestimmte Tabellen gemeinsam haben.
Bei Datenkatalogansichten wird die Ausgabe der Anweisung durch die Lake Formation Formation-Zugriffskontrolle gesteuert und es werden nur die Spalten angezeigt, auf die der Aufrufer Zugriff hat.
Syntax
SHOW COLUMNS {FROM|IN} database_name
.table_or_view_name
SHOW COLUMNS {FROM|IN} table_or_view_name
[{FROM|IN} database_name
]
Die FROM
- und IN
-Schlüsselwörter können synonym verwendet werden. Wenn table_or_view_name
or database_name
enthält Sonderzeichen wie Bindestriche. Umgeben Sie den Namen in umgekehrte Anführungszeichen (z. B.). `my-database`.`my-table`
Umgeben Sie nicht table_or_view_name
or database_name
mit einfachen oder doppelten Anführungszeichen. Derzeit wird die Verwendung von LIKE
- und Mustervergleichsausdrücken nicht unterstützt.
Beispiele
Die folgenden äquivalenten Beispiele zeigen die Spalten aus der orders
-Tabelle in der customers
-Datenbank. Die ersten beiden Beispiele gehen davon aus, dass customers
die aktuelle Datenbank ist.
SHOW COLUMNS FROM orders
SHOW COLUMNS IN orders
SHOW COLUMNS FROM customers.orders
SHOW COLUMNS IN customers.orders
SHOW COLUMNS FROM orders FROM customers
SHOW COLUMNS IN orders IN customers